PRIMARY FUNCTION:

Provide comprehensive case management services to children and families who are involved in the child protection system, both voluntarily and involuntarily, on the Red Lake Indian Reservation. Work directly with children and parents to preserve and/or reunify the family and achieve safety and well-being for children in a stable home environment whenever possible. Report to the Executive Director, full-time position w/benefits, salary; DOQ.

D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:

• Case Management services to families with children at risk of placement or currently in placement; including developing a case/safety plan, facilitating supervised visits, providing face-to-face visits with family a minimum of once a month, among other duties.

• Must be able to perform required billing practices in accordance with Child Welfare Targeted Case Management (CWTCM), and reimbursement activities under Title IV-E.

• Knowledgeable of the Red Lake Tribal Codes relating to child welfare services. Preparation of court reports, and attend court hearings.

• Develops and reviews individual plans; provide preventative services to children and families.

• Arrange for necessary meetings with other resource agencies and provide referrals to ensure the family receives appropriate, culturally relevant services.

• Participate in professional development training and educational activities; Attend staff and case management meetings.
